PHP — это язык программирования, который поддерживает несколько основных типов данных, необходимых для создания динамических веб-приложений. Давайте рассмотрим основные типы данных, которые поддерживает PHP:
Целые числа (Integer)
Целые числа представляют собой числовые значения без дробной части. В PHP они имеют диапазон от -2,147,483,648 до 2,147,483,647 в 32-битных системах. Пример:
$a = 1234; // положительное целое число
$b = -123; // отрицательное целое число
Числа с плавающей запятой (Float/Double)
Эти числа представляют собой числовые значения с дробной частью. Они обычно используются для более точного представления значений. Пример:
$c = 1.234;
$d = -1.2e3; // это тоже float
Строки (String)
Строки представляют собой последовательность символов и текстовых данных. Строки можно создавать с использованием одинарных или двойных кавычек. Пример:
$name = "John";
$greeting = 'Hello, world!';
Булевы значения (Boolean)
Булевы значения имеют только два возможных значения: true или false. Они полезны для контроля потока выполнения программы.
$isTrue = true;
$isFalse = false;
Массивы (Array)
Массивы в PHP используются для хранения нескольких значений в одном переменной. Они могут быть как одномерными, так и многомерными.
$fruits = array("apple", "banana", "cherry");
$vehicles = ["car" => "Toyota", "bike" => "BMW"];
Объекты (Object)
Объекты позволяют вам хранить данные и функции вместе. Объекты создаются на основе классов.
class Car {
function Car() {
$this->model = "VW";
}
}
$herbie = new Car();
NULL
NULL — это специальное значение, означающее отсутствие значения или недействительность.
$var = NULL;
Ресурсы (Resource)
Ресурсы представляют собой ссылки на внешние ресурсы, такие как файловые указатели или соединения с базами данных. Обычно они создаются с помощью специальных функций.
Каждый из этих типов данных служит своей цели и позволяет разработчикам писать более эффективные и гибкие программы на PHP.
Категория: Программирование
Теги: веб-разработка, программирование на PHP, компьютерные науки